University of Hamburg, Germany

Dr. Bernd Page

Dr. Bernd Page

Professor for Applied Computer Science
Department of Informatics
University of Hamburg
Germany

"The Department of Informatics at the University of Hamburg has received significant support from TIBCO to further research in simulation technology. Our research group is developing the object-oriented simulation framework DESMO-J based on Java and UML over many years and has employed the framework extensively in our simulation courses and projects. A significant number of DESMO-J simulation classes have been adopted and integrated into TIBCO's Eclipse-based modelling and design environment, Business Studio. This collaboration has been of mutual benefit to us and I fully support this program."
